helically annelated and cross conjugated oligothiophenes asymmetric synthesis resolution and characterization of a carbon sulfur 7 helicene
Journal of the American Chemical Society, 2004Co-Authors: Andrzej Rajca, Maren Pink, Makoto Miyasaka, Hua Wang, Suchada RajcaAbstract:The synthesis and characterization of a novel oligothiophene, in which the thiophene rings are annelated into a [7]helicene with cross-conjugated pi-system, are described. Such [7]helicenes may be viewed as fragments of the unprecedented carbon-sulfur (C(2)S)(n)() helix, possessing sulfur-rich molecular periphery. Racemic synthesis of [7]helicene is based upon iterative alternation of two steps: C-C bond homocouplings between the beta-positions of thiophenes and annelation between the alpha-positions of thiophenes. Asymmetric synthesis is carried out using (-)-sparteine-mediated annelation of the axially chiral bis(aryllithium) with electrophilic sulfur equivalent. Alternatively, enantiomers of the [7]helicene are obtained via resolution using menthol-based chiral siloxanes. Racemic [7]helicene and four other macrocyclic products of the annelation are characterized by X-ray crystallography. One of the solvent polymorphs of the [7]helicene possesses pi-stacked columns of opposite enantiomers and multiple short intermolecular contacts, including both homochiral and heterochiral short S...S contacts, suggesting an effective intermolecular electronic coupling in two-dimensions. The [7]helicene is configurationally stable at room temperature and racemizes at 199 degrees C with a half-time of about 11 h. Selected physicochemical studies (UV-vis absorption, CD, optical rotation, and cyclic voltammetry) of the [7]helicene are described.

cross conjugated oligothiophenes derived from the c2s n helix asymmetric synthesis and structure of carbon sulfur 11 helicene
Journal of the American Chemical Society, 2005Co-Authors: Makoto Miyasaka, Andrzej Rajca, Maren Pink, Suchada RajcaAbstract:(−)-Sparteine-mediated asymmetric synthesis of di-n-octyl-substituted carbon−sulfur [11]helicene, a helical (C2S)n β-undecathiophene, is described. The atom-efficient routes rely on one-step tri-annelation or two-step di- and mono-annelation to provide enantiomeric excess of (+)- or (−)-[11]helicene, respectively. X-ray structures for homologous [11] and [7]helicenes indicate similar helical curvatures. The optical band gap, Eg ≈ 3.5 eV, is estimated for the (C2S)n helix polymer, with onset of electron localization at n ≤ 7.

development of a 3 3 approach to tetrahydropyridines and its application in indolizidine alkaloid synthesis
Tetrahedron, 2008Co-Authors: Lisa C Pattenden, Harry Adams, Stephen A Smith, Joseph P. A. HarrityAbstract:Abstract A stepwise [3+3] annelation sequence is described that generates tetrahydropyridines from the corresponding aziridines. The scope of this process is described and its potential for the stereoselective synthesis of indolizidines is highlighted by the synthesis of (−)-monomorine.

formal synthesis of perhydrohistrionicotoxin via a stepwise 3 3 annelation strategy
Tetrahedron Letters, 2006Co-Authors: Olivier Y Provoost, Simon J Hedley, Andrew J Hazelwood, Joseph P. A. HarrityAbstract:Abstract A formal synthesis of (±)-perhydrohistrionicotoxin is described that includes a highly diastereoselective modified Sharpless aziridination and a stepwise [3+3] annelation reaction for the stereoselective construction of the key spiropiperidine motif.
